The African Petroleum Regulators Forum (AFRIPERF) has been officially established in Accra, Ghana, marking a historic milestone in continental energy cooperation. The signing ceremony was led by the Chief Executive of the Nigerian Upstream Petroleum Regulatory Commission (NUPRC), Engr. Gbenga Komolafe, alongside his Sudanese counterpart, Mr. Alsadig Mahmoud Gabir, and other stakeholders. The creation of AFRIPERF underscores Nigeria’s leadership role in shaping policies to harmonise the oil and gas regulatory

environment across Africa.

The policy underpinning AFRIPERF seeks to provide a unified platform for petroleum regulators to exchange ideas, align frameworks, and establish common standards for the industry.

 

This collaboration will enhance cross-border cooperation, reduce policy inconsistencies, and boost investor confidence. By presenting a collective African voice on regulatory matters, AFRIPERF positions the continent as a stronger player in global energy governance.

One of the forum’s key objectives is to attract greater investment into Africa’s oil and gas sector.

 

By harmonising rules and providing clearer operating environments, AFRIPERF will reduce investor uncertainty and create opportunities for large-scale infrastructure projects, joint ventures, and financing partnerships that can drive economic growth across member states.

 

Beyond investment, AFRIPERF also prioritises sustainability, energy transition, and regional stability.

 

By aligning regulatory frameworks, member countries will be better equipped to adopt clean energy policies, manage resources responsibly, and strengthen local content participation. Under President Bola Ahmed Tinubu’s reform-driven administration, Nigeria’s leadership in this initiative reflects its commitment not only to domestic energy security but also to shared continental prosperity
